Somalia president links Ethiopia pullout to UN deployment

DJIBOUTI (AFP) — Somalia's president told a UN Security Council mission Monday that a UN peacekeeping mission must be deployed in his country before Ethiopian troops can withdraw.

"The eventual withdrawal of the Ethiopian troops from Somalia is contingent on the deployment of the United Nations peacemaking force and the cessation of hostilities," Abdullahi Yusuf Ahmed said.

"I would like to state very clearly that there should not be a security vacuum in Somalia," he added.
